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/lang/openjdk11 openjdk11: enable support for NetBSD-*-...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/b8e647ff35b5
branches:  trunk
changeset: 431065:b8e647ff35b5
user:      tnn <tnn%pkgsrc.org@localhost>
date:      Sat May 09 00:55:44 2020 +0000

description:
openjdk11: enable support for NetBSD-*-aarch64. Add bootstrap binaries.

Only works on -current. See PR port-evbarm/55248 for 9.0 caveats.

diffstat:

 lang/openjdk11/bootstrap.mk |  27 ++++++++++++++++++---------
 lang/openjdk11/distinfo     |   6 +++++-
 2 files changed, 23 insertions(+), 10 deletions(-)

diffs (61 lines):

diff -r bd5dd5b2807d -r b8e647ff35b5 lang/openjdk11/bootstrap.mk
--- a/lang/openjdk11/bootstrap.mk       Sat May 09 00:09:15 2020 +0000
+++ b/lang/openjdk11/bootstrap.mk       Sat May 09 00:55:44 2020 +0000
@@ -1,19 +1,28 @@
-# $NetBSD: bootstrap.mk,v 1.3 2019/11/03 19:04:04 rillig Exp $
+# $NetBSD: bootstrap.mk,v 1.4 2020/05/09 00:55:44 tnn Exp $
 
-ONLY_FOR_PLATFORM=             NetBSD-*-i386 NetBSD-*-x86_64
+
+ONLY_FOR_PLATFORM+=            NetBSD-*-i386
 BOOT.nb7-i386=                 bootstrap-jdk-1.11.0.5.8-netbsd-7-i386-20190928.tar.xz
 SITES.${BOOT.nb7-i386}=                ${MASTER_SITE_LOCAL:=openjdk11/}
+.if !empty(MACHINE_PLATFORM:MNetBSD-*-i386) || make(distinfo)
+DISTFILES+=                    ${BOOT.nb7-i386}
+EXTRACT_ONLY+=                 ${BOOT.nb7-i386}
+.endif
+
+ONLY_FOR_PLATFORM+=            NetBSD-*-x86_64
 BOOT.nb7-amd64=                        bootstrap-jdk-1.11.0.5.8-netbsd-7-amd64-20190928.tar.xz
 SITES.${BOOT.nb7-amd64}=       ${MASTER_SITE_LOCAL:=openjdk11/}
-
-.if !empty(MACHINE_PLATFORM:MNetBSD-*-i386) || make(distinfo)
-DISTFILES+=            ${BOOT.nb7-i386}
-EXTRACT_ONLY+=         ${BOOT.nb7-i386}
+.if !empty(MACHINE_PLATFORM:MNetBSD-*-x86_64) || make(distinfo)
+DISTFILES+=                    ${BOOT.nb7-amd64}
+EXTRACT_ONLY+=                 ${BOOT.nb7-amd64}
 .endif
 
-.if !empty(MACHINE_PLATFORM:MNetBSD-*-x86_64) || make(distinfo)
-DISTFILES+=            ${BOOT.nb7-amd64}
-EXTRACT_ONLY+=         ${BOOT.nb7-amd64}
+ONLY_FOR_PLATFORM+=            NetBSD-*-aarch64
+BOOT.nb9-aarch64=              bootstrap-jdk-1.11.0.7.10-netbsd-9-aarch64-20200509.tar.xz
+SITES.${BOOT.nb9-aarch64}=     ${MASTER_SITE_LOCAL:=openjdk11/}
+.if !empty(MACHINE_PLATFORM:MNetBSD-*-aarch64) || make(distinfo)
+DISTFILES+=                    ${BOOT.nb9-aarch64}
+EXTRACT_ONLY+=                 ${BOOT.nb9-aarch64}
 .endif
 
 CONFIGURE_ENV+=                LD_LIBRARY_PATH=${ALT_BOOTDIR}/lib
diff -r bd5dd5b2807d -r b8e647ff35b5 lang/openjdk11/distinfo
--- a/lang/openjdk11/distinfo   Sat May 09 00:09:15 2020 +0000
+++ b/lang/openjdk11/distinfo   Sat May 09 00:55:44 2020 +0000
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.15 2020/05/07 09:09:15 tnn Exp $
+$NetBSD: distinfo,v 1.16 2020/05/09 00:55:44 tnn Exp $
 
 SHA1 (bootstrap-jdk-1.11.0.5.8-netbsd-7-amd64-20190928.tar.xz) = d76599619b8bea879b8202b3efc38a82335d2e8c
 RMD160 (bootstrap-jdk-1.11.0.5.8-netbsd-7-amd64-20190928.tar.xz) = a1b998e4e7edfb73ec35b0cc94895d9af16a8cd8
@@ -8,6 +8,10 @@
 RMD160 (bootstrap-jdk-1.11.0.5.8-netbsd-7-i386-20190928.tar.xz) = ec41da372ab1f927295a207a65a2a5f940760339
 SHA512 (bootstrap-jdk-1.11.0.5.8-netbsd-7-i386-20190928.tar.xz) = 1bf5336e9bfeea9ecbcd347f2ea8dd3c9633df42cab13a09c7afaae94faa95b92d862dd97caf380a7037825c3324377240d5d0639b2e0b31a2d7a6316ed56359
 Size (bootstrap-jdk-1.11.0.5.8-netbsd-7-i386-20190928.tar.xz) = 96662264 bytes
+SHA1 (bootstrap-jdk-1.11.0.7.10-netbsd-9-aarch64-20200509.tar.xz) = a1339a72f399c154104fcf46766b4c259ac24783
+RMD160 (bootstrap-jdk-1.11.0.7.10-netbsd-9-aarch64-20200509.tar.xz) = edf0054b7c2fa2eff641b2c385a4f9de07eb0247
+SHA512 (bootstrap-jdk-1.11.0.7.10-netbsd-9-aarch64-20200509.tar.xz) = 735f47d7398a48f0963c5d629c6c319dfe22d84bacd45f84a34f4784433c8cf6bfe6b356363a4591f035bec4a32e2e38d0a9c6be361aa57e5f0170ad4e16a1ad
+Size (bootstrap-jdk-1.11.0.7.10-netbsd-9-aarch64-20200509.tar.xz) = 99673444 bytes
 SHA1 (openjdk-jdk11u-jdk-11.0.7-10-2.tar.gz) = a4a3ae9f7d214d08b89ff16a5f794e0650a15288
 RMD160 (openjdk-jdk11u-jdk-11.0.7-10-2.tar.gz) = e46bb700a915d30f22e7e29a7f533b55c16c8e21
 SHA512 (openjdk-jdk11u-jdk-11.0.7-10-2.tar.gz) = 79d35e9f78e3823154fa009cfd99d57841368fcec5db63fb1375cb447116a00d65bb81d3f73de26ae1c730384ab0cc7741276835a40eb34300d60ec08cab7b8c



Home | Main Index | Thread Index | Old Index